Concept: The POSH Act, 2013 (Prevention of Sexual Harassment at Workplace Act) establishes a structured mechanism for addressing complaints of workplace sexual harassment.

Step 1:
Beginning of the complaint process.
The procedure starts when the aggrieved woman files a written complaint before the Internal Complaints Committee (ICC). Thus, B is the first step.

Step 2:
Inquiry by the ICC.
After receiving the complaint, the ICC conducts an inquiry by examining evidence, witnesses, and statements of both parties. Thus, D is the second step.

Step 3:
Recommendation by the ICC.
Once the inquiry is completed, the ICC submits its recommendations to the employer regarding disciplinary action or other remedies. Thus, A is the third step.

Step 4:
Implementation by employer.
The employer is legally bound to implement the recommendations made by the ICC within the prescribed period. Thus, C is the final step.
